Product details

Overview

SN74BCT29853DWR from Texas Instruments is an 8-bit to 9-bit BiCMOS bus transceiver with integrated parity generator/checker, TTL-compatible inputs/outputs, open-collector ERR flag, and latch-enable/clear control. It operates from 4.5 V to 5.5 V at 0°C–70°C and supports bidirectional asynchronous data transfer between A and B buses with real-time parity validation.

For engineers reviewing the SN74BCT29853DWR datasheet, SN74BCT29853DWR pinout, SN74BCT29853DWR application, or SN74BCT29853DWR equivalent, key selection criteria include its flow-through pinout, inverted-parity diagnostic mode, ERR flag latching behavior, and BiCMOS standby current reduction versus legacy TTL bus transceivers.

Technical Context

The SN74BCT29853DWR implements a dual-mode 9-bit parity engine: it generates odd parity during A→B transmission and checks parity (including forced-inverted parity for diagnostics) during B→A transmission. Its ERR output is open-collector and can be sampled, stored via LE, or cleared via CLR - independent of bus direction control.

Control logic decodes OEA/OEB states to enable A→B transfer with parity generation, B→A transfer with parity checking, isolation mode (both enables high), or inverted-parity mode (OEA=OEB=L). The device uses BiCMOS process technology to achieve TTL-level interface compatibility while reducing ICCZ to 30–45 mA versus standard bipolar 29853 variants.

Key Specifications

Parameter Value and Actual Design Meaning
Supply Voltage 4.5 V to 5.5 V - compatible with standard 5 V TTL/CMOS system rails without level-shifting.
Operating Temperature 0°C to 70°C - specified for commercial-grade embedded and industrial control applications.
Propagation Delay 1 ns to 10 ns - ensures sub-10 ns bus turnaround in high-speed backplane or memory-mapped I/O systems.
Output Drive −24 mA IOH / 48 mA IOL - sufficient to drive multiple TTL loads or terminated transmission lines.
ERR Output Type Open-collector - allows wired-OR fault-bus architectures and direct connection to 3.3 V or 5 V interrupt controllers.
Parity Function Odd parity generation and checking - detects single-bit errors on 8-bit data + 1 parity bit paths.
Standby Current 30–45 mA ICCZ - reduced vs. bipolar equivalents, enabling lower power in idle bus segments.

Pinout & Package

SN74BCT29853DWR is housed in a 24-pin SOIC (DW) package with 300-mil width and gull-wing leads. Pin 1 is marked by a beveled corner or notch; the package is RoHS-compliant per TI's Pb-Free (RoHS) eco plan.

Pin/Terminal Circuit Role Design Meaning
OEA Output Enable A Active-low control enabling A-port drivers; when low, A1–A8 drive B1–B8 (with parity gen).
A1–A8 Data Inputs / Outputs (A side) Bidirectional I/O ports for A bus; function as inputs when OEA high, outputs when OEA low.
ERR Parity Error Flag Open-collector output asserting low on parity mismatch; requires external pull-up for logic-high state.
CLR Clear Input Active-low asynchronous reset of ERR latch; forces ERR output high regardless of parity state.
GND Ground Reference Primary return path for all internal logic and I/O currents; must be low-impedance for noise immunity.
VCC Power Supply +5 V supply rail; decoupling capacitor required within 1 cm of pin to suppress switching noise.
B1–B8 Data Inputs / Outputs (B side) Bidirectional I/O ports for B bus; function as inputs when OEB high, outputs when OEB low.
PARITY Parity Output 9th-bit output reflecting odd parity of A1–A8; used as input during B→A parity check mode.
OEB Output Enable B Active-low control enabling B-port drivers; when low, B1–B8 drive A1–A8 (with parity check).
LE Latch Enable Active-high edge-triggered strobe capturing current ERR state into internal latch for diagnostic hold.

Key Features

Feature Design Value
Flow-through pinout All inputs (A1–A8, OEA, OEB, LE, CLR) located on left side; all outputs (B1–B8, PARITY, ERR) on right - simplifies PCB routing and reduces crosstalk.
Inverted-parity diagnostic mode When OEA=OEB=L, generated parity is inverted to force ERR assertion - enables hardware-level fault injection for system self-test.
ERR flag latching LE input captures transient parity errors for persistent fault reporting, eliminating need for continuous polling or fast ISR response.
BiCMOS process Combines TTL input thresholds with CMOS-like standby current (ICCZ ≤ 45 mA), reducing thermal load in dense bus interfaces.
Functionally equivalent to Am29853 Direct drop-in replacement for AMD's industry-standard 29853 in legacy designs, preserving timing, pinout, and logic behavior.

Applications

Backplane Data Transfer Industrial PLC I/O Modules

Use Scenario: Asynchronous data exchange between CPU and peripheral cards across a 24-pin parallel backplane with error detection.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Bidirectional 8-bit transceiver with real-time parity generation/checking and latched error flag for fault logging.

Use Value: Enables single-bit error detection without software overhead; ERR latch holds fault state until cleared by host controller.

Use Scenario: Isolating and validating sensor/actuator data between field-side and controller-side buses in programmable logic controllers.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Parity-aware bus interface IC managing data integrity across galvanically isolated communication links.

Use Value: Detects wiring faults or EMI-induced bit flips on noisy factory-floor buses; open-collector ERR integrates directly with PLC interrupt inputs.

Legacy System Bus Expansion Diagnostic Test Equipment

Use Scenario: Extending ISA or VMEbus-based systems with additional memory-mapped peripherals requiring parity-protected data paths.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: High-speed TTL-compatible transceiver providing flow-through layout and sub-10 ns propagation for cycle-accurate timing.

Use Value: Maintains strict timing compliance with legacy bus protocols while adding hardware-level parity validation previously implemented in FPGA logic.

Use Scenario: Embedded self-test subsystem in automated test equipment that validates data path integrity before functional testing.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Programmable parity injector/checker using inverted-parity mode (OEA=OEB=L) to force known-error conditions.

Use Value: Eliminates need for external pattern generators during production test; ERR latch captures pass/fail status for automated result capture.

Equivalent & Alternatives

The following parts are listed as comparable options for similar 8-bit parity transceiver applications.

Alternative Part Technical Difference Application Difference Selection Advice
SN74BCT29853NT Dual-in-line package (PDIP, NT), same electrical specs and pinout; higher thermal resistance and larger footprint. Suitable for through-hole prototyping or legacy board rework where SOIC reflow is unavailable. Select SN74BCT29853NT only when manual assembly or socket-based debugging is required.
Am29853PC Identical function and pinout; bipolar process yields higher ICCZ (≈120 mA) and slower tPLH/tPHL (≈15 ns typical). Compatible in existing Am29853-based designs but increases power and reduces maximum bus frequency. Choose Am29853PC only if BiCMOS availability is constrained and system thermal budget permits higher standby current.

Compared with SN74BCT29853NT and Am29853PC, the SN74BCT29853DWR delivers identical functionality in a space-efficient SOIC package with 60% lower standby current and 30% faster propagation - making it optimal for new designs prioritizing density and power efficiency.

Manufacturer

Texas Instruments is a global semiconductor company founded in 1930, specializing in analog, embedded processing, and logic solutions for industrial, automotive, and communications markets.

The SN74BCT29853DWR belongs to TI's BCT-series advanced bus-interface logic family, designed specifically for high-reliability, parity-protected data transfer in commercial-grade computing and control systems.

FAQ

What is the primary function of the SN74BCT29853DWR in a data bus system?

The SN74BCT29853DWR serves as an 8-bit bidirectional bus transceiver with integrated odd-parity generation and checking. During A→B transfer, it appends a parity bit; during B→A transfer, it validates that parity. Its ERR output flags mismatches, and the latch-enable (LE) and clear (CLR) inputs allow controlled capture and reset of error states - making the SN74BCT29853DWR essential for hardware-level data integrity in mission-critical bus architectures.

Does the SN74BCT29853DWR support both 3.3 V and 5 V logic levels?

No, the SN74BCT29853DWR is a 5 V-only device with TTL-compatible input thresholds (VIH = 2 V min, VIL = 0.8 V max) and operates strictly from 4.5 V to 5.5 V. It does not tolerate 3.3 V supply or I/O voltages. Driving its inputs from 3.3 V sources may cause undefined logic states; level translation is required for mixed-voltage systems using the SN74BCT29853DWR.

How does the inverted-parity mode work on the SN74BCT29853DWR?

When both OEA and OEB are low, the SN74BCT29853DWR enters inverted-parity mode: it generates even parity instead of odd parity during A→B transfer, forcing the ERR output active (low) regardless of data content. This provides a deterministic fault condition for system diagnostics - allowing engineers to verify ERR path integrity, latch behavior, and interrupt handling without injecting actual bit errors. The SN74BCT29853DWR's datasheet explicitly defines this as a design feature for enhanced testability.

Can the ERR output of the SN74BCT29853DWR drive multiple loads directly?

Yes - the ERR output is open-collector and rated for 20 µA leakage at VOH = 2.4 V, supporting wired-OR configurations. It can sink up to 48 mA (IOL), enabling direct connection to multiple 5 V interrupt inputs or pull-up resistors. However, total capacitive load must remain ≤50 pF to meet specified 1.5–24 ns timing; exceeding this degrades setup/hold margins for LE- and CLR-triggered operations in the SN74BCT29853DWR.
